Well, this was fun. A cocky little so-and-so I work with just challenged me.

I was going on a much needed coffee/smoke break, and he was leaving for the night. On his way out, he stopped at tonight'* Sup'* dek, and saw me reading the other kill stories, and asked if I thought I could take his Fiero.

I figured "What the hell" and headed out for break. Turns out he has an early model rusty white Fiero. He points it out kinda proudly and asks "So, what do you think" I'm polite and say it looks pretty cool. My Bonne is right by the door, so I hop in and fire her up.

Well, he suddenly remembers he has to meet some friends at the bar and has to get going. "Maybe next weekend". Guess he didn't realize what was under the hood, huh? And I'm just an old NA with a modded airbox.

So, can just the sound of the engine scaring him off be considered a kill?
